Posted by Michael Coate (Member # 757) on 10-02-2005, 05:11 PM:
I saw the trilogy back-to-back-to-back on May 24, 1990, the day before "Part III" was released. I'm sure many of you remember this event, which was held in a handful of cities across the country. I attended the screening at the GCC Avco in Westwood Village, CA. Number 86 in line (first 100 received a souvenir T-shirt boasting that you saw the future back-to-back-to-back)... 1,200-seat auditorium... THX... 70mm... Audience full of die-hard fans... The works... Needless to say, this was perhaps the best six hours I ever spent at the movies! It sure beat the hell out of sitting through the five-movie "Rocky-thon" I made the mistake of attending later that year.
